Whitepaper Analysis: Why Standard Lenses Fail and How Medical-Grade Layering Solutions Dominate the B2B Market
For individuals with deep dark brown irises, standard semi-translucent color lenses lead to muddy hues. Advanced opacity micro-patterning utilizes a dense titanium dioxide formulation combined with biological dyes to create a complete light block while maintaining a natural, feathered transition zone at the pupil cutout.
Direct pigment contact with the cornea causes micro-abrasions and long-term ocular fatigue. High-tier suppliers utilize Double-cladding Sandwich Printing Technology, wrapping the color layers between two inert layers of Hydrogel or Silicone Hydrogel materials, preventing pigment exposure and maximizing comfort.
Thicker opaque printing often restricts cellular gas exchange. Innovative manufacturers use Laser-Microperforated Pigment Networks, which leave tiny interstitial spaces within the printed color pattern, ensuring the lens maintains a high physiological Dk/t value for dry eye prevention.

The Evolution of High-Performance Contact Lens Materials and Smart Bio-Integration Technologies
Modern consumers demand continuous safety. The next major transition point is moving opaque decorative lenses from HEMA-based structures to high-oxygen Silicone Hydrogel (SiHy) platforms, maintaining optimal moisture levels during prolonged 12-hour wear sessions.
In-house R&D is currently prototyping photochromic pigments that dynamically shift tone density based on ambient UV index levels, allowing a vibrant light hazel look under indoor lighting and a deeper, rich caramel tone in outdoor environments.
